Description
Delicious Creamy Quinoa Broccoli and Cheese Casserole, packed with roasted broccoli, quinoa, cannellini beans, and a cheesy sauce. Perfect for a comforting, hearty dinner for the whole family.
Ingredients
- 2 cups low-sodium vegetable or chicken broth
- 1 cup uncooked quinoa, rinsed
- 1/4 tsp ground black pepper
- 1/2 tsp kosher salt
- 2 tbsp extra virgin olive oil
- 1 lb broccoli florets
- 2 tbsp all-purpose flour
- 3 medium carrots, diced
- Chopped fresh herbs (optional)
- 1 cup non-fat milk
- 1 15-oz can cannellini beans, drained and rinsed
- 1 tsp kosher salt
- 1 tsp dried oregano
- 1 tsp minced garlic
- 1/4 tsp ground black pepper
- 1 cup plain nonfat Greek yogurt
- 1 tbsp extra virgin olive oil
- 3/4 cup mozzarella, fontina, or provolone cheese
- 1 small yellow onion, finely diced
- 1/8 tsp cayenne pepper
- 3/4 cup sharp cheddar cheese
- 1 cup low-sodium vegetable or chicken broth (for casserole base)
Instructions
- Cook quinoa in 2 cups broth over low boil for 15 minutes. Let stand 5 minutes and fluff with a fork.
- Preheat oven to 400°F. Toss broccoli with 2 tbsp olive oil, 1/2 tsp salt, 1/4 tsp pepper, and roast 15–20 minutes until browned and crisp.
- Heat 1 tbsp olive oil in a Dutch oven. Sauté onion and carrots for 5 minutes. Add garlic, 1 tsp salt, 1/4 tsp pepper, and cook 30 seconds.
- Sprinkle flour, cook 30–60 seconds. Slowly whisk in 1 cup broth, then milk in small amounts. Simmer 5 minutes until sauce thickens. Stir in oregano and cayenne.
- Fold in cooked quinoa, cannellini beans, and roasted broccoli. Stir in Greek yogurt, 1/2 cup mozzarella, and 1/2 cup cheddar until combined.
- Transfer to casserole dish. Top with remaining cheddar and mozzarella. Bake at 350°F for 15 minutes. Broil 3–4 minutes until cheese lightly browned. Let rest 5 minutes.
- Garnish with chopped fresh herbs and serve.
Notes
- Use fresh parsley or chives for garnish.
- Substitute plant-based milk if desired.
- Prep Time: 25 minutes
- Cook Time: 50 minutes
- Category: Casserole
- Method: Bake
- Cuisine: American